Durability and Longevity
A key consideration in the brass vs steel belt buckle debate is durability. Brass resists corrosion and develops a patina that improves rather than degrades over time. Steel may withstand force, but often shows scratches and oxidation without aesthetic enhancement. Visual and Tactile Elegance
Visual character distinguishes a brass belt buckle from a steel one beyond functional performance. Brass offers a warm, golden tone that complements traditional leather hues such as dark brown, black, and oxblood. It develops subtle colour variations and depth through oxidation, enhancing the narrative of a well-loved, high-quality accessory.
Tactile experience further differentiates brass. UK luxury buyers respond to brass’s weight, smoothness, and solid feel, which communicate confidence and substance.
